Gail Ann Dorsey

I Used to Be

2004-05-20

Gail Ann Dorsey has established herself as a session and touring bassist over a career that has spanned 20 years - working with Tears for Fears, Bryan Ferry, Dar Williams, The Indigo Girls and, for the last 10 years, on tour and in the studio with David Bowie.

Now she's returning to the solo route with her first release since 1992 and her third overall. I Used to Be appears on her independent Sad Bunny label. The disc features two collaborations with Roland Orzabal of Tears for Fears along with a mix of pop and soul compositions.
